Ограничение равенства всех коэффициентов, mlogit, Stata

#constraints #stata #mlogit

#ограничения #stata #mlogit

Вопрос:

У меня есть многочленная логит-модель, которую я хочу оценить с помощью mlogit. Я хочу ограничить коэффициенты для одной из независимых переменных (но не для остальных) равными во всех альтернативах. Я пробовал следующие ограничения, но всегда получаю сообщение об ошибке от Stata: «номер ограничения # вызвал ошибку r (198))»:

 constraint define 1 [1=2]var_name  
constraint define 2 [1=3]var_name  
constraint define 3 [1=4]var_name  
constraint define 4 [1=5]var_name  
 

или

 constraint define 1 [1]var_name = [2]var_name  
constraint define 2 [1]var_name = [3]var_name  
constraint define 3 [1]var_name = [4]var_name  
constraint define 4 [1]var_name = [5]var_name  
 

Всего существует 6 альтернатив, я использую 6-ю в качестве основы. Любая помощь будет высоко оценена.

Ответ №1:

Попробуйте что-то вроде этого:

 webuse sysdsn1
tab insure
constraint 1 [Prepaid]age=[Uninsure]age
mlogit insure age male nonwhite i.site, base(1) constraint(1)
 

Комментарии:

1. Когда я пытаюсь сделать это со страховыми данными, это работает, но с моими данными я получаю ошибку (111).